Understanding the Fluid Nature of Live Betting
Live betting offers a thrilling twist to traditional wagering by allowing participants to place bets as events unfold in real time. This dynamic form of betting demands not only quick judgment but also adaptability to sudden changes. Unlike pre-match betting, where odds are fixed before the event starts, live betting constantly shifts based on ongoing developments. This can be both an opportunity and a challenge for those who want to capitalize on fluctuating odds.
Many platforms now support live betting with real-time data feeds and instant updates, frequently powered by sophisticated providers like Evolution and Pragmatic Play. These technologies enable bettors to adjust their strategies on the fly, reacting to unexpected moments such as injuries, red cards, or momentum swings. However, navigating these sudden turns requires a clear mind and a solid understanding of the sport or game involved.
Key Strategies for Staying Ahead in Live Betting
It’s tempting to chase every shifting odd, but successful live betting is more about precision than frequency. One practical tip is to focus on markets and events you know well; knowledge of team tactics, player form, or game flow can provide a crucial edge. For instance, in football or basketball, understanding how a team reacts under pressure or after losing a key player can help anticipate adjustments in live odds.
Another important strategy is managing your bankroll carefully. Live betting can be fast-paced and emotionally charged, which might lead to impulsive decisions. Setting clear limits and sticking to them prevents reckless losses. It’s also useful to watch for line movements and compare odds offered by different bookmakers in real time—some platforms allow seamless switching, giving bettors a chance to maximize value.

Common Pitfalls and How to Avoid Them
One of the most frequent mistakes newcomers make is overconfidence in predicting immediate outcomes, which often results in impulsive bets right after a big play. It’s crucial to remember that momentum in sports can be deceiving and sometimes temporary. Overreacting to small swings can drain your bankroll quickly.
Another challenge is the “information overload” phenomenon. Live betting platforms bombard users with stats, odds, and live commentary. While having data is an advantage, overanalyzing every single update can cloud judgment and slow reaction time. Instead, prioritize key metrics relevant to your betting strategy and tune out noise that doesn’t contribute to decision-making.

What to Keep in Mind for Responsible Live Betting
Live betting’s fast pace is part of its appeal, but it also means there’s a higher risk of impulsive wagers that can escalate losses. It’s important to approach live betting with a mindset of entertainment rather than guaranteed profit. Always recognize your limits and never bet money you cannot afford to lose. Using self-exclusion tools and setting deposit caps are practical ways to maintain control.
Keeping a level head and respecting responsible gambling principles ensure that the excitement of live betting remains enjoyable and sustainable over time. After all, the unexpected twists in live events are what make this form of wagering so captivating, but they also demand respect and caution.
